How Lithium Batteries Cause Workshop Fires
Lithium batteries store high energy in a compact form. If damaged, overcharged, or exposed to excessive heat, they can enter a state called thermal runaway. This process releases heat and gases, which may ignite surrounding materials. Even a single faulty cell can trigger a chain reaction, making safe charging practices for lithium battery packs critical in any workshop environment.

Recognizing the Warning Signs of Battery Failure
Early detection is key to garage tool chest fire prevention. Signs of battery failure include swelling, unusual heat, strange odors, or visible leaks. If you notice these symptoms, stop using the battery immediately and dispose of it safely according to local regulations.

Best Locations for Charging Cordless Tool Batteries
Choose a flat, non-flammable surface away from direct sunlight and combustible materials. Avoid charging inside enclosed tool drawers unless they are specifically designed for ventilation. Open benchtops or dedicated charging shelves are safer alternatives.
Proper Ventilation in Tool Drawers and Chests
Ventilation is crucial when charging batteries in storage units. Ensure your tool chests or drawers have built-in vents or leave drawers partially open during charging. This helps dissipate heat and reduces the risk of fire.

Setting Up a Fire-Safe Charging Station
Dedicate a specific area for charging, away from flammable materials. Use fire-resistant mats and keep a fire extinguisher nearby. Label each charger and battery, and implement a routine for inspecting batteries before and after charging.
Smart Storage Solutions: Organize, Label, and Isolate
Store batteries separately from metal tools to prevent short circuits. Use labeled bins or drawers for charged, uncharged, and faulty batteries. This system streamlines workflow and enhances safety.
